Ecological regulations play a crucial part in shaping how companies operate, including barber shops. These rules are designed to protect the environment and public health by managing waste disposal, air quality, and water usage. Hairdressing shops, while primarily focused on haircare and grooming, must also adhere to these regulations to ensure they do not impact the natural surroundings. Recognizing these guidelines helps barber shop owners achieve compliance and promote a sustainable business model.



One significant component of ecological regulations affecting grooming establishments is waste management. Salons produce various types of debris, including cuttings, chemical products, and packaging materials. Laws often mandate these businesses to implement specific removal practices to reduce contamination and environmental load. For instance, hair clippings can be recycled or reused for green initiatives, while hazardous byproducts must be disposed of according to local guidelines. By handling disposables responsibly, haircare providers give back positively to their communities and the environment.

Indoor air standards is another essential aspect impacted by ecological policies. Many barber shops use products that useful link release VOCs, which can harm indoor air quality. Laws may limit the use of certain substances in hair dyes and styling products, encouraging stylists to select more eco-friendly alternatives. Switching to greener ingredients not only improves atmospheric safety but also appeals to clients who prioritize sustainability. Haircare businesses can enhance their brand image by committing to green practices that benefit both patrons and the environment.



Water usage is also regulated by eco policies that can impact daily operations in barber shops. Many areas have restrictions on water use due to drought conditions or other environmental concerns. Grooming facilities need to implement conservation strategies, such as efficient tap systems and efficient washing methods for towels and tools. These practices not only help comply with regulations but also lower utility costs for shop managers. By being mindful of water consumption, haircare providers can contribute in conserving this vital element.
